Full Job Description
Job Description

In this role you will own the product strategy, roadmap, and commercialization approach for predictive model-based products serving pharmaceutical and payer customers within Quest Diagnostics. You will translate market needs, customer workflows, and analytic opportunities into scalable products that operationalize predictive models, risk scores, and decision-support insights. You will partner closely with data science, engineering, clinical, and commercial teams to define product requirements, prioritize delivery, validate market fit, and ensure that predictive model products are reliable, explainable, compliant, and commercially valuable.

Responsibilities

  • Define and maintain the vision, strategy, and roadmap for predictive model-based products serving the HAS and Quest ecosystem.
  • Partner with commercial leaders, customer-facing teams, and key clients to validate product-market fit and prioritize roadmap investments
  • Collaborate with the MBTs to translate market needs into reusable product capabilities rather than one-off customer customizations
  • Evaluate and identify high-value use cases for predictive models, including patient finding, risk stratification, provider targeting, care management, and market access workflows
  • Support Market Backed Teams in developing business cases, and value narratives as needed for predictive model products
  • Translate customer and business needs into clear product requirements, user stories, acceptance criteria, and release priorities
    Work closely with data scientists to shape model-backed product requirements including explainability, performance thresholds, monitoring, and refresh strategies
  • Drive disciplined backlog prioritization and make trade-offs that balance customer value, technical effort, and strategic differentiation
  • Partner with engineering and data teams to ensure product feasibility, scalable implementation, and operational readiness
  • Define success metrics for product performance model utilization, revenue contribution, retention, and workflow impact
  • Lead cross-functional alignment across products, data science, engineering, operations, compliance, legal, and commercial stakeholders
  • Support customer presentations, and the development of product enablement materials for internal and external audiences as a part of go-to-market planning
  • Ensure predictive model products are positioned responsibly with appropriate attention to data quality, model governance, interpretability, and healthcare compliance


Qualifications

Required Work Experience:
• 5+ years of product management experience in analytics, data, AI/ML, healthcare technology, or related B2B products
• 3+ years working with predictive models, advanced analytics products, decision-support tools, or data-intensive healthcare products
• Experience translating commercial or customer needs into product requirements for technical teams
• Experience working cross-functionally with data science, engineering, and business stakeholders
• Experience in healthcare, life sciences, diagnostics, payer analytics, pharmaceutical analytics, or another regulated domain

Preferred Work Experience:
• 7+ years of product management experience
• Experience launching predictive model products for pharma, payer, provider, or population health use cases
• Experience with commercialization of AI/ML products including positioning, pricing, packaging, and adoption strategy
• Experience working with claims, lab, EMR/EHR, specialty pharmacy, market access, or patient services data
• Familiarity with model governance, explainability, monitoring, and regulated healthcare data environments

Physical and Mental Requirements:
• Open mindset and ability to quickly adopt new technologies and practices
• Ability to maintain focus across multiple priorities and synthesize complex technical and business inputs

Knowledge:
• Product management for data, analytics, and predictive model-based offerings
• Healthcare and life sciences commercial workflows, especially pharma and payer use cases
• Predictive model product lifecycle including model deployment, monitoring, refresh, and explainability
• Data privacy, HIPAA, and healthcare compliance considerations relevant to product design
• Modern analytics and data platforms sufficient to make strong product trade-offs

Skills:
• Strategic product thinking and roadmap prioritization
• Strong written and verbal communication across executive, commercial, and technical audiences
• Customer discovery, market research, and business case development
• Ability to influence without authority and drive alignment across cross-functional teams
• Strong analytical reasoning and comfort working with technical concepts, data products, and model-driven decision support
